Equities Roundup: Estate Management, Chip Makers Outperform

- Stocks trading moderately firmer ahead midday, off initial post-data lows as markets looked to PPI down revisions and soft airfare, insurance components. Currently, the DJIA is up 51.82 points (0.13%) at 39483.5, S&P E-Minis up 11.25 points (0.21%) at 5256.25, Nasdaq up 82.7 points (0.5%) at 16468.6.
- Leading Gainers: Real Estate and Information Technology sectors outperformed in the first half, estate management and investment trusts buoyed the former: Boston Property +1.75%, Healthpeak Properties +1.58%, Prologis +1.54%. Semiconductor stocks supported the IT sector in early trade: Enphase +3.71%, Qualcomm +1.88%, Teradyne +1.75%.
- Laggers: Energy and Consumer Staples sectors underperformed in the first half, oil and gas companies weighed on the former: Marathon Petroleum -4.41%, Diamondback Energy -1.29%, Philips66 -1.14%. Meanwhile, household products weighed on the latter, Clorox -1.42%, Church & Dwight -0.8%, Kimberly-Clark -0.74%.
- Late cycle earnings releases still expected this week: CIsco, B Riley, Walmart, Deere & Co, Applied Materials and Take Two Entertainment.
